Registration Number:027043-LOC-12117 Ca' Manzoni apartment is located in an historical palace which dates back to 1300, and its name comes from the abbess Marianna Manzoni who in 1762 radically restored it, as the commemorative plaque on its façade witnesses. The apartment is a few minutes walk from Piazza S.Marco and near the famous theatre La Fenice, in an ideal position to discover the most famous but also the most fascinating and less popular places of marvellous Venice. It has been recently restored under the expert coordination of the owner Luisa, keeping the romantic Venetian character and atmosphere of the past unaltered: it has the entrance on the fourth and last floor and it overlooks three sides of the palace. The living room has a remarkable view over the wide campo S. Maurizio where a periodic and characteristic antiques market takes place; from the living room you can admire important gothic buildings and the homonymous neoclassic church built by the Venetian architect Gianantonio Selva with its majestic bell tower. The double room, with its original antique ceiling made of wooden trusses and an antique fireplace between two windows is furnished in a typical Venetian style and has a warm and comfortable atmosphere. The apartment is inside the church called "Chiesa di SAN GIOVANNI ELEMOSINARIO" one of the oldest churches in the Rialto area built in the 11th century, the only church saved from a fire that broke out in the 15th century and by 1700 it had become the priest’s house.   • How is the weather in Lignano Sabbiadoro?

    Lignano Sabbiadoro has mild winters around 31–49°F (0–9°C), and warm summers that reach 64–85°F (18–29°C). Spring and autumn see moderate temperatures and occasional rainfall, so packing for changing conditions is helpful.

  • What is Lignano Sabbiadoro known for?

    Lignano Sabbiadoro is known for its long sandy beaches, vibrant nightlife, and lively summer atmosphere. The town also has pine forests and a marina, making it popular for outdoor and water-based activities.
